WebOct 12, 2024 · Though it is known for its safety and nutritional value, like any food, there are signs that sea moss gel is going bad. These signs include: 1. The color of the gel changes from a deep green to a lighter green or even yellow. 2. The texture of the gel changes from smooth and slick to stringy or lumpy. 3. WebDec 9, 2024 · Organic sea moss gel generally lasts 3 to 4 weeks in the fridge if kept in an airtight container. However, if not refrigerated, it starts deteriorating and going bad within a few days or hours, depending on the temperature. Stay away from any industrial sea moss gel that claims to be good for more than 4 weeks.
